1012030001 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 1012030002. Its totient is φ = 1012030000.

The previous prime is 1012029979. The next prime is 1012030037. The reversal of 1012030001 is 1000302101.

It is a weak pr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 873261601 + 138768400 = 29551^2 + 11780^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is a de Polignac number, because none of the positive numbers 2k-1012030001 is a prime.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(1012030091)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 506015000 + 506015001.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(506015001).
